CX RACING intercooler

Has anyone ever used a CX racing intercooler before. If so is it any good or should i invest in a different one. And what other brands are out there that will fit a LT1 styled front end. My car is a 1994 6spd Z28. I plan on doing at least 6psi for now. Thanks for looking

Re: CX RACING intercooler

They're a good budget intercooler. Usually run into a restriction around 800 or so hp. Plenty of guys have gone 9's on them. You can look up "ebay intercooler" on LS1Tech for plenty of feed back.
